2.Determination of milrinone nitrogen oxides in milrinone by HPLC-MS/MS
Lan SHEN ; Jieli LI ; Ke SHI ; Shunli JI
Journal of China Pharmaceutical University 2025;56(3):336-340
In this study, high-performance liquid chromatography coupled with tantrum mass spectrometry (HPLC-MS/MS) technology was employed to determine milrinone nitrogen oxides in milrinone. An ACCHROM XCharge-C18 column (100 mm × 2.1 mm, 5 μm) was used with a mobile phase consisting of A phase (methanol) and B phase (5 mmol/L NH4FA, pH3 adjusted by formic acid). Agilent 6410B triple quadrupole mass spectrometer was used for HPLC-MS/MS analysis. Detection was performed using positive electrospray ionization (ESI+) in multiple reaction monitoring (MRM) mode to analyze the limit of milrinone nitrogen oxides in milrinone, and the quantitative transition for the ion pair was from m/z 228.01 to m/z 181.90. Experimental results showed that the method exhibited good specificity, and that neither blank solvent nor blank samples interfered with the determination of milrinone nitrogen oxides of milrinone. The method demonstrated high sensitivity, with a limit of quantitation (LOQ) of 0.0076 μg/mL and a limit of detection (LOD) of 0.0038 μg/mL. The linear range spanned from 20% to 200% of the LOQ concentration, and a good linear relationship between concentration and peak area was observed within this range. Additionally, the recovery rates were consistently within the range of 80% to 120%, and the RSD for repeatability tests was 12.0%. These results indicated that the precision and accuracy of this method meet the required standards. In summary, the method developed in this study can effectively and accurately determine the content of milrinone nitrogen oxides in milrinone.
3.Progress in targeted inhibition of aerobic glycolysis combined with immunotherapy for renal cell carcinoma.
Kun ZHANG ; Mengyao RU ; Jiayuan WANG ; Jumei ZHAO ; Lan SHEN
Chinese Journal of Cellular and Molecular Immunology 2024;40(1):74-79
Tumor aerobic glycolysis is one of the main features of tumor metabolic reprogramming. This abnormal glycolytic metabolism provides bioenergy and biomaterials for tumor growth and proliferation. It is worth noting that aerobic glycolysis will not only provide biological materials and energy for tumor cells, but also help tumor cells to escape immune surveillance through regulation of immune microenvironment, thereby resisting tumor immunotherapy and promoting tumor progression. Based on the pathogenesis of renal cell carcinoma, this paper describes the characteristics of aerobic glycolysis, the effect of glycolytic metabolism on the immune microenvironment of renal cell carcinoma, the effect of glycolysis inhibitors on the immune microenvironment of renal cell carcinoma, and the prospect of glycolysis inhibitors combined with immune checkpoint inhibitors in the treatment of renal cell carcinoma.

5.Self-management and family support among elderly patients with type 2 diabetes in community: based on semi-structured interviews
Lan ZHU ; Zhigang PAN ; Fulai SHEN
Chinese Journal of General Practitioners 2024;23(2):126-131
Objective:To investigate the status of self-management and family support among elderly diabetic patients in community.Methods:Eight elderly patients with type 2 diabetes were interviewed in Xietu Community Health Service Center in Shanghai by semi-structured interviews from March 1st to March 15th, 2022. The interview outline focused on the impact of the disease on the patients' daily life, the status of disease self-management, and the support provided by their family. The contents of interviews were analyzed and extracted by Colaizz 7-step analysis method.Results:Of the 8 interviewees, there were 2 males and 6 females, aged (75.25±3.01)years old, with a disease course of (17.50±8.50)years. The interviews showed that there were three themes in the area of family support: difficulties in disease management (in terms of diet, exercise, medication, disease surveillance, health knowledge and quitting unhealthy habits), helpfulness of family support in management of above behaviors, differences between family support and support from others (including eating habits, information sharing, emotional support, patient trust, and continuity of support).Conclusions:The elderly diabetic patients in the community have some awareness of health management, but there is still much room for improvement. The supervision and support from family members can help patients improve their self-management and quality of life.

7.Application of seminar in addition to case-based learning in physical therapy practical teaching
Lan ZHU ; Chuan GUO ; Sisi HUANG ; Panpan JI ; Yihui CHENG ; Ying SHEN
Chinese Journal of Rehabilitation Theory and Practice 2024;30(3):368-372
Objective To explore the effect of seminar based on case-based learning(CBL)in practical teaching of physical therapy. Methods From July,2021 to June,2022,42 rehabilitation therapy students for internships in Rehabilitation Medicine Center,the First Affiliated Hospital of Nanjing Medical University were non-directionally recruited,and random-ly divided into control group(n = 21)and experimental group(n = 21).The experimental group received instruc-tion using seminar and CBL,while the control group received CBL alone,for three months.The scores of theoret-ical and practical assessments were observed,and the satisfaction was investigated using a self-designed question-naire. Results The scores of both theoretical and practical assessments were better in the experimental group than in the control group(t>2.421,P<0.05);while the satisfaction was better in terms of motivating learning enthusiasm,enhanc-ing learning abilities,cultivating clinical reasoning skills,improving teacher-student communication,promoting teamwork,enhancing overall competence,and satisfying to the teaching in the experimental group than in the control group(χ2>6.667,P<0.05). Conclusion The combination of seminar with CBL would enhance the effect of practical teaching in physical therapy.
8.Effects of 1,25(OH)2 D3 regulation of vitamin D receptor expression on H2 O2-induced oxidative stress injury in nucleus pulposus cells
Zhe SHEN ; Tao LAN ; Wei-Zhuang GUO
The Chinese Journal of Clinical Pharmacology 2024;40(3):373-377
Objective To investigate the effect of 1,25(OH)2 D3-mediated vitamin D receptor(VDR)expression on oxidative stress injury in nucleus pulposus cells.Methods Human interdisc nucleus pulpocytes were randomly divided into control group,H2O2 group(400 μmol·L-1H2O2),1,25(OH)2 D3 group[100.00 nmol·L-11,25(OH)2D3+400 μmol·L-1H2O2],1,25(OH)2D3+si-NC group[100.00 nmol·L-1 1,25(OH)2D3+400 μmol·L-1 H2O2+si-NC],1,25(OH)2D3+si-VDR group[100.00 nmol·L-1 1,25(OH)2D3+400 μmol·L-1 H2O2+si-VDR].Cell survival rate was measured by methyl thiazolyl tetrazolium(MTT)assay.Western blot assay was used to detect the protein expression level of each group.Apoptosis,mitochondrial membrane potential and reactive oxygen species(ROS)levels were detected by flow cytometry,JC-1 fluorescence probe and DCFH-DA probe,respectively.Malonclialdehyde(MDA)and superoxide dismutase(SOD)levels were detected with the kit.Results The cell survival rates of control group,H2O2 group,1,25(OH)2D3 group,1,25(OH)2D3+si-NC group and 1,25(OH)2D3+si-VDR group were(100.00±2.43)%,(63.79±5.21)%,(90.11±7.24)%,(88.79±6.48)%and(55.31±4.65)%;VDR protein levels were 0.79±0.06,0.28±0.03,0.68±0.05,0.69±0.06 and 0.34±0.04;the apoptosis rates were(4.12±0.26)%,(19.37±1.21)%,(8.49±0.57)%,(8.23±0.60)%and(14.68±1.37)%;mitochondrial membrane potential levels were(100.00±4.31)%,(49.46±5.02)%,(82.14±7.02)%,(83.14±5.12)%and(67.16±5.48)%;ROS levels were 1.79±0.12,7.98±0.51,3.87±0.34,3.92±0.22 and 5.79±0.28;Beclin-1 levels were 0.86±0.09,0.35±0.04,0.76±0.07,0.75±0.08 and 0.46±0.05;LC3-Ⅱ/LC3Ⅰ levels were 1.00±0.07,0.25±0.04,0.78±0.07,0.85±0.08 and 0.42±0.05,respectively.Compared H2 O2 group with control group,compared 1,25(OH)2 D3 group with H2O2 group,compared 1,25(OH)2D3+si-VDR group with 1,25(OH)2D3+si-NC group,the differences of the above indicators were all statistically significant(all P<0.05).Conclusion 1,25(OH)2 D3 may up-regulate the expression of VDR,promote autophagy and inhibit apoptosis of nucleus pulposus cells,and play an anti-oxidative stress role.
9.Advances in the construction of models and applications of Alzheimer's disease based on microfluidic chips
Piao-xue YOU ; Lan CHEN ; Shu-qi SHEN ; Liang CHAO ; Hui WANG ; Zhan-ying HONG
Acta Pharmaceutica Sinica 2024;59(6):1569-1581
Alzheimer's disease (AD) is a progressive neurodegenerative disease associated with dysfunctions related to thinking, learning, and memory of the brain. AD has multiple pathological characteristics with complicated causes, constructing a suitable pathological model is crucial for the research of AD. Microfluidic chip technology integrates multiple functional units on a chip, which can realize microenvironmental control similar to the physiological environment. It is well applied in the construction of pathological model, early diagnosis as well as drug screening of AD. This paper focuses on the construction of AD microfluidic chips model from the perspective of cell type, culture formats and the chips structure as well as the research progress of microfluidic chips in AD application based on the pathological characteristics of AD, which will provide a reference for further elucidation of AD mechanism and drug development.
10.The therapeutic efficacy of combining acupuncture with ice-water balloon dilatation in the treatment of cricopharyngeal dystonia
Huiling WANG ; Jing GAO ; Xin SHEN ; Xiaoyan LAN ; Xiaodong FENG
Chinese Journal of Physical Medicine and Rehabilitation 2024;46(9):781-785
Objective:To observe the clinical efficacy of supplementing penetrating acupuncture for swallowing with ice-water balloon dilatation in the treatment of dysphagic patients with cricopharyngeal achalasia after a brainstem stroke.Methods:Forty-five patients with cricopharyngeal achalasia after a brainstem stroke were randomly assigned to a penetrating acupuncture (PA) group, a balloon dilatation (BD) group or a combination group, each of 15. In addition to routine swallowing training, those in the PA and BD groups received penetrating swallowing acupuncture or iced-water balloon dilatation, while the combination group received penetrating swallowing acupuncture 30 minutes after iced-water balloon dilatation. The treatments lasted three weeks beginning right after the recovery of autonomous oral feeding. Before and after the treatment, all of the subjects′ swallowing function was evaluated using video fluoroscopy (VFSS), a functional oral intake scale (FOIS) and a penetration aspiration scale (PAS). Successful removal of the gastric tube, gastric tube retention time and normal opening rate of the cricopharyngeal muscle were also recorded.Results:Significant improvement was observed in the average VFSS, FOIS and PAS results of all three groups after the treatments. The combination group′s average VFSS, FOIS and PAS scores were, however, significantly superior to those of the other two groups, as were successful removal of the gastric tube, gastric tube retention time and the normal opening rate of the cricopharyngeal muscle.Conclusion:Combining penetrating swallowing acupuncture with ice-water balloon dilation can better improve the swallowing function of brainstem stroke survivors with cricopharyngeal achalasia. It improves the cricopharyngeal opening rate and shortens gastric tube indwelling time. This combination of traditional Chinese and Western medicine is therefore worthy of clinical promotion and application.
